将Python代码转换为DLL可导出代码的方法是什么?

将Python代码转换为DLL可导出代码的方法是什么?,python,python-3.x,dll,dllexport,Python,Python 3.x,Dll,Dllexport,我在Windows10平台上。我想在另一个代码中使用我的Python代码。我知道DLL是我能做到的一种方法。但我还没有找到任何方法将Python代码转换为DLL。任何人都可以分享我想要达到的目标。下面是Python的示例代码: import numpy as np def test(abc): # abc is numpy array c = np.sum(abc) return c 请让我知道我能做什么。如果有人有这样的例子,那么它会很有帮助。@CristiFati请让我知

我在Windows10平台上。我想在另一个代码中使用我的Python代码。我知道DLL是我能做到的一种方法。但我还没有找到任何方法将Python代码转换为DLL。任何人都可以分享我想要达到的目标。下面是Python的示例代码:

import numpy as np

def test(abc): # abc is numpy array
    c = np.sum(abc)
    return c

请让我知道我能做什么。如果有人有这样的例子,那么它会很有帮助。

@CristiFati请让我知道你所说的上述链接是什么意思?我看不到我的查询的答案。在离开始不远的地方(在“Cython Hello World”一章中),有这样一个文本:“它将在您的本地目录中留下一个文件,在unix中名为helloworld.so,在Windows中名为helloworld.pyd。现在使用这个文件:启动python解释器,并简单地将其作为常规python模块导入:”. 它尽可能清楚,这意味着这个软件包正是您所需要的。@CristiFati感谢您的澄清。但这不是我的问题的答案。我想要一个DLL。我知道DLL相当于PYD,但如果需要的话,它在其他程序中并不有用。它只适用于Python.Oh,所以您需要在Python外部使用“regular.dll”(很抱歉,假设相反:))。嗯,那也许你可以用麻木。你也可以考虑。